We are looking for an experienced, self-motivated Human Resources Business Partner - HRBP to help drive planning and execution for one of our game teams.

Key Responsibilities:
  1. Build a thorough understanding of the team and overall business operations, as well as HR strategies and initiatives, to develop people plans that support the overall business goals.
  2. Work with our People Ops team throughout Zynga and Take-Two to own, develop and drive people plans across the employee lifecycle to meet changing business needs, supporting the achievement of our overall business objectives.
  3. Partner with creative and technical teams on HR strategies and initiatives to enhance performance and organizational effectiveness.
  4. Drive consistent talent routines within your business areas to maintain talent health and accelerate development.
  5. Partner with local and global HRBPs on strategic projects and programs.
  6. Work with Zynga and TakeTwo teams to effectively deliver HR initiatives within your business areas including Total Rewards, Learning & Development, Diversity, Equity & Inclusion, Social and community projects and ERGs.
  7. Proactively work with client group and HR leadership to propose and drive new HR initiatives that align with business needs.
  8. Resolve and anticipate complex issues that impact multiple teams across related HR areas, employee relations or other employee issues.
Required Skills:
  1. Deep experience of partnering with dynamic and creative teams and business leaders, able to demonstrate results through people projects.
  2. Able to own and drive HR work, translating global initiatives into local projects.
  3. Operated in a matrixed, fast-paced, global and rapidly-changing business environment; public company experience preferred.
  4. A strong solutions focus, ability to quickly identify problems and drive appropriate solutions.
  5. Great communication skills. An excellent connector who collaborates and always keeps the broader team in mind.
  6. Demonstrates resiliency by celebrating wins while learning from mistakes.
  7. Ability to assess the needs of a team and provide relevant solutions.
  8. Ability to work effectively in an environment with a high level of ambiguity.
  9. Strong client partner with business acumen.
